About 9-phenyl-1-[1-[4-phenyl-6-(9-phenyldibenzothiophen-4-yl)-1,3,5-triazin-2-yl]carbazol-9-yl]carbazole

9-phenyl-1-[1-[4-phenyl-6-(9-phenyldibenzothiophen-4-yl)-1,3,5-triazin-2-yl]carbazol-9-yl]carbazole (PubChem CID 168807829) has the molecular formula C57H35N5S and a molecular weight of 822.01 g/mol. Its IUPAC name is 9-phenyl-1-[1-[4-phenyl-6-(9-phenyldibenzothiophen-4-yl)-1,3,5-triazin-2-yl]carbazol-9-yl]carbazole.
